Output 52023ecab584f30270334d59ee25ce43e2088a50561994ab4e8631c3e633d425:0

value
18993652500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bdcf3cbd22c939f2c3feb624b782c658ce06b4c OP_EQUAL
address
MN7HfCbuYbBL52HG2zckzLSnD5LdLo3sfB
transaction
52023ecab584f30270334d59ee25ce43e2088a50561994ab4e8631c3e633d425
spent
true